IB 6118 Flight Delayed: Compensation

If your Iberia Airlines flight IB 6118 departing Miami heading to Madrid got delayed, you may be eligible for compensation for a flight delay, which depends on circumstances of a flight disruption. Regulation EU EC261/ 2004 is a European Union regulation that mandates the right to compensation for flight delay inconvenience and lost time for every passenger affected regardless of ticket price and if somebody else paid for tickets.

However, the EU Regulation does not require Iberia Airlines to pay compensation for minor delays less than 3 hours. Eligibility criteria for valid compensation claim requires that your flight IB 6118 must arrive in Madrid at least 3 hours late. The distance between Madrid and Miami is the one of the major factors that influences the amount of compensation that you might be able to claim for your flight IB 6118.

Tip: If Madrid is not your final destination, the amount of compensation must be calculated based on the distance between the point of your original departure: Miami and your ultimate final destination if both flights are booked under the same reservation.

IB 6118 Flight Cancelled: Right to Claim a Refund

Iberia Airlines is responsible to honour your refund request for the price of flight ticket and to reimburse passengers for any additional out of pocket expenses incurred as a result of flight IB 6118 cancellation. If you arranged and paid for a rebooking of an alternative flight, Iberia Airlines shall compensate any such expenses. Iberia Airlines shall also cover reasonable costs of a temporary hotel stay in case of overnight delay.

It is important to properly track all expenses and keep originals of all receipts. This would be required by lawyers to build up a legal case. When shall Iberia Airlines pay compensation for your flight IB 6118 disruption?

YES

Iberia Airlines shall pay compensation

Technical problemsOperational problemsLate arrival of another flightIberia Airlines employees strikeIberia Airlines economic problems

NO

Iberia Airlines is not responsible for flight IB 6118 disruption

Strike of airport personnelSevere storm (not just bad weather)Air Traffic Control problemsSecurity issuesBird strikeProblems with passenger’s travel documents
